Inertia Dampers


A stepper motor operated at its natural frequency may experience excessive settling time, vibration and acoustic noise. A Ferrofluidic damper relies on Ferrofluid to absorb the motion energy by a shearing effect which produces a torque that opposes the unwanted oscillatory motion. A Ferrofluidic damper is hermetically sealed and has a non-magnetic housing which attaches to the motor shaft. Inside the housing is an inertial mass which levitates on Ferrofluidics' ferrofluid, thus eliminating the need for bearings to support the mass.

 

A Ferrofluidics damper offers reliable damping and accurate performance with no losses in speed or accuracy, and no reduction in torque. Other performance benefits include:

  • increased positional accuracy
  • reduced settling time
  • reduced torsional oscillations

A Ferrofluidic inertia damper is easily attached to the motor shaft and has no maintenance requirements. It can be custom tuned to your system for optimum results. Typical applications include X-Y-Z Plotters, Printers, Optical Scanners, Robotics and Milling Machines.

A range of sizes and damping coefficients is available.
